Retroreflective graphics that stay true to color by day and light up bright by night
Reflective vinyl decals are printed on vinyl film embedded with microscopic glass beads or microprismatic lenses that bounce light back toward its source. In daylight they look like a normal color print; under headlights or a flashlight, they flash bright. They're used for
truck decals,
fleet decals,
USDOT decals, safety labeling, and personal gear where nighttime visibility matters.

Key Takeaways
- Reflective vinyl decals use a retroreflective layer (glass beads or microprisms) beneath the printed surface — this is what makes them glow under direct light.
- Two main grades exist: engineer grade reflective vinyl (standard visibility, lower cost) and high-intensity reflective vinyl (brighter, wider viewing angle, built for commercial and roadside use).
- Solid black areas in artwork will not reflect light — bright colors like white, yellow, orange, and red reflect the most.
